Is a Digital Marketing Course Truly Worth the Investment in 2026?

The short answer is: selectively, yes. The value of a digital marketing course in 2026 depends significantly on its alignment with current industry demands and your specific career or business objectives. Certifications from recognized platform providers (like Google, Meta) and credible practitioner-education institutions hold genuine professional weight. Generic online course certificates without industry standing, however, offer minimal value.

A digital marketing certification can be incredibly helpful for building practical skills, staying current with tools, and demonstrating to employers the ability to work with modern marketing systems. If your goal is to enter the field, transition roles, or acquire specific technical skills, a certification provides a practical and cost-effective starting point. It enables the development of competence in areas such as paid media, analytics, or content performance without the commitment of a longer academic program.

The Digital Marketing Skills Gap

Despite the rapid growth of the digital economy and the influence of digital transformation on every organization, there's a significant digital marketing skills gap. This gap is most pronounced in data analytics, Search Engine Optimization (SEO), content marketing, and digital strategy. Many professionals lack the necessary expertise to effectively leverage digital tools, leading to missed opportunities and competitive disadvantages for businesses. This growing demand for up-to-date digital skills makes targeted education a valuable asset.

The job market for digital marketing professionals is robust. Core marketing roles are projected to grow faster than the average for all occupations. However, there's a clear shift in hiring toward more experienced and analytically capable workers, with senior-level job postings outpacing broader growth rates. This underscores the need for certifications that go beyond basic understanding and provide strategic insights and practical application.

Evaluating Digital Marketing Courses: A PS TECH GLOBAL Framework

When considering an investment in a digital marketing course, we advise a rigorous evaluation process. Not all courses are created equal, and a strategic choice can yield substantial ROI, both for individuals and businesses.

Key Considerations for Business Leaders and Aspiring Professionals

  1. Curriculum Relevance and Depth: Does the course cover the latest trends and technologies? In 2026, this means strong emphasis on AI-driven marketing, predictive analytics, first-party data strategies, and advanced SEO techniques (including Generative Engine Optimization). A comprehensive program should offer modules in SEO, content marketing, social media marketing, email marketing, paid advertising (PPC), data analytics, and marketing automation.
  2. Instructor Credentials and Industry Experience: Are the instructors practitioners with real-world experience, or merely academics? Look for courses taught by professionals who actively work in the digital marketing field and can share practical insights and case studies.
  3. Practical Application and Hands-on Projects: The ability to apply theoretical knowledge is paramount. Courses should offer hands-on projects, simulations, or case studies that mirror real-world scenarios. This ensures that learners develop job-ready skills.
  4. Accreditation and Recognition: While a university degree remains the gold standard for long-term career foundations, platform-specific certifications (e.g., Google Ads, Meta Blueprint, HubSpot) are highly valued by employers for demonstrating specific tool proficiency. Look for certifications from reputable institutions or industry bodies.
  5. Community and Networking Opportunities: A vibrant learning community can provide invaluable peer support, networking opportunities, and access to industry mentors.
  6. Career Support and Placement Assistance: For individuals, look for courses that offer career counseling, resume building, interview preparation, and job placement assistance.
  7. Cost-Benefit Analysis and ROI: Assess the total cost of the course (tuition, materials, time commitment) against the potential benefits (salary increase, career advancement, business growth). Calculate the potential ROI to ensure it aligns with your investment objectives.

Comparing Digital Marketing Education Pathways

To further illustrate the varying options, we have prepared a comparative table:

Feature Digital Marketing Certifications Bootcamps/Specialized Programs University Degrees (e.g., MBA with Marketing Specialization)
Focus Specific skills, tool proficiency (e.g., Google Ads, SEO, Social Media). Intensive, practical training in specific domains (e.g., Data Analytics for Marketing, Performance Marketing). Broad strategic understanding, consumer behavior, business decision-making, theoretical foundations.
Duration Short-term (weeks to a few months) Medium-term (few months to a year) Long-term (1-4 years)
Cost (Estimated) INR 5,000 - INR 50,000 (USD 60 - USD 600) INR 50,000 - INR 3,00,000 (USD 600 - USD 3,600) INR 5,00,000+ (USD 6,000+)
Industry Recognition High for platform-specific and reputable industry certifications. Growing, especially from well-known providers with strong alumni networks. Very high, often a prerequisite for senior leadership roles.
Career Impact Immediate skill enhancement, entry-level roles, specific job functions. Faster career transition, specialized roles, upskilling for existing professionals. Long-term career growth, leadership positions, holistic business understanding.
Ideal For Beginners, professionals needing specific skill updates, validating expertise. Career changers, those seeking rapid skill acquisition, or deep dives into niche areas. Aspiring marketing leaders, those seeking a comprehensive academic foundation.
Expert Takeaway: For businesses, consider upskilling existing teams with targeted certifications and bootcamps that address immediate skill gaps, especially in AI-driven strategies and data analytics. For individuals, combine platform-specific certifications with a strong portfolio of practical projects to demonstrate tangible value. This blended approach offers the best of both worlds: specialized expertise and strategic acumen.

Real-World Impact: Measuring ROI of Digital Marketing Education

Measuring the Return on Investment (ROI) of digital marketing education can be multifaceted. For businesses, this might mean tracking improved campaign performance, higher conversion rates, reduced customer acquisition costs, or enhanced brand recognition attributed to the newly acquired skills of their team. For individuals, ROI can be measured in terms of salary increases, promotions, or successful career transitions.

We systematically analyze the latest data from sources like the U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ics, which projects robust growth for advertising, promotions, and marketing managers, with a median annual wage for marketing managers of USD 161,030 in May 2024. Wage gains for marketing professionals are significantly outpacing general salary growth, with an 8.7% year-over-year increase in 2024. These figures underscore the financial incentive for upskilling in this field.

According to a 2026 report, 78% of marketing and creative leaders now pay more for candidates with specialized skills, and nearly half of recruiters use skills data when filling roles. This emphasizes that while experience is valuable, formally validated skills through certifications are increasingly important for career progression.
